All essential PBR maps are included to accurately represent the material’s physical properties across modern pipelines: the Albedo/BaseColor map conveys the characteristic rusty hues and dirt-streaked pigments while the Normal map captures the dented pitted surface geometry enhancing light interaction. The Roughness map defines varying gloss levels between corroded and less weathered areas reflecting the uneven surface finish. Metallic values denote the predominantly metal substrate balanced to preserve rusted and oxidized zones. Ambient Occlusion highlights crevices and recessed dents for enhanced depth perception and the Height/Displacement map provides subtle relief for added realism in parallax or tessellation workflows. Using This PBR Texture in Blender
Import the texture maps into Blender with sRGB color space for albedo/base color and
Non-Color for normal, roughness, metallic, AO, height, and ORM maps. Connect normal maps
through a Normal Map node, then adjust UV scale with a Mapping node so the material repeats naturally on
your model.
- Albedo -> Principled BSDF Base Color
- Roughness -> Roughness, Metallic -> Metallic
- Normal -> Normal Map node -> Normal
- Height -> Bump or Displacement depending on render setup
